I just recently got a hold of the new TBS Vendetta and wanted to do a quick review for you guys
Both the TBS Vendetta and the TBS Crossfire come in some neat black boxes with TBS symbols and even quotes on the side of the boxes.
Inside the boxes, you are presented with the Vendetta with the arms off, couple of screws, straps, and 2 sets of 5x4x3 Gemfan props.
As for the TBS Crossfire you get the crossfire unit, antenna, a couple of cables for different transmitter connections and a JR module converter.

As I'm using a Taranis I simply plugged in the JR connection, connected the JR cables (RC Input & Expansion port) to the crossfire unit (remember to connect the antenna first), and then configured a model with internal RF off and external RF to CRSF
And ... nothing happened. The module isn't turning on ... why?
Everything was connected perfectly but as it turns out maybe too perfectly. The JR pins weren't making contact with the JR module so no power was being forwarded. I simply bent the JR pins ever so slightly to make sure there is contact and after powering up the taranis everything is now working fine
You only need to do a few things to get the Vendetta flying which doesn't take long.
Firstly, unscrew the two screws that hold up the front bumper. You can now (slowly) slide the internal carriage with all components out of the carbon shell.
I'm using a micro crossfire receiver (you can use anything PPM or SBUS tho and there is even a servo connector ready for you to plug in your receiver).
As the crossfire receiver plug doesn't take servo connectors I simply exchanged the lead (supplied with receiver).
Bind before you get the internals back inside and you are almost ready to go.
Now you only need to couple the legs into the frame and screw them in.
Get in the arms protection (supplied) and screw that in too.
Now you just need to screw back the front bumper, place the battery straps and you are almost there!
Before powering up your craft remember to set your radio endpoints to 1000-2000 and 1500 for middle stick
Power up your Vendetta - REMEMBER TO PUT THE ANTENNA ON!!!
You will be prompted by a OSD screen to calibrate your remote. Pretty standard. Make sure you have a 3 point switch for modes.
You are able to change almost everything using OSD and sticks, such as your PIDS, RATES, VTX FREQ, and several other settings.
That's it! You are ready to fly.
Yaw right and test the prop rotation before you put props on.
If you want to add a switch simply connect it to cleanflight and do it ther under MODES.

And how does it fly?
First flight RAW video
Brilliantly!!
I can honestly say this has been the most enjoyable quad I've ever flown from first go.
I was able to go to places I'd normally crash before without thinking about it.
It has a feeling of locked in and agile BUT ... not super fast (yet).
I'm running 4s 50-100c 1500mha Drone labs and feel the slight lack of punch that I have on other quads.
The smoothness of it fully compensates for it tho and I can't say that I've pushed it to it's limits yet.
I'm using 5x4x3 DAL props and the motors get slightly warm at the end of a fast session.
I didn't notice much difference (aside from noise) from the 5x4x3 HQ props included.
And the camera?
Yes, it is not that good but it's usable as long as you have a sunny day.
Going into dark spots is not very fun as you can barely see where you are going.
There are two options.
- You can exchange it for a different FPV camera
- You can change the settings.
Changing the settings is actually harder then it sounds, as in order to be able to connect an OSD keyboard you will need to open up the camera and move a soldered mini component inside.
By Trappy:
Ok, the instructions are as follows. There is a 0R component that needs to be moved. Since it's 0R (0 Ohm resistance) it can also be replaced by a blob of solder. this is located near the image sensor, an area marked with "A" for Audio, and "K" for Keypad, one of them connected to the center pad (= output port). Basically it jumps the audio output port either to the keypad input, or the microphone. 2 photos for reference.
TROUBLESHOOTING
Stick input doesn't work in calibration startup
FOR SBUS:
Connect to cleanflight, go to configuration and set RX_SERIAL under Receiver Mode and SBUS under Serial Receiver Provider
Save and the board will restart. UART 2 should have activated SERIAL RX automatically, but double check it.
FOR PPM:
Connect to cleanflight, go to configuration and set RX_PPM under Receiver Mode
Save and the board will restart.
You should now have stick input in the OSD
Cannot get to OSD (yaw left + throttle low) after calibration startup
Firstly set your remote endpoints to 1000-2000 and 1500 for middle stick.
You should check this directly in cleanflight.
Then you will need to access the OSD via the three tiny buttons directly in the TBS CORE
Middle button long press = main menu
Middle button short press = ok
Left button = up
Right button = down
Go to general option and factory default after the end points are correctly setup on your remote.
Redo the initial calibration.
Cannot get Vendetta to arm
Set your radio endpoints to 1000-2000 and 1500 for middle stick if you haven't before.
You should check this directly in cleanflight.
Go to general option and factory default after the end points are correctly setup on your remote.
Redo the initial calibration.
If you still cannot arm by right yaw+ low throttle connect to cleanflight and set a switch from your remote to arm, under modes
